1. Drastic Weight Reduction: Unleash the "Cub's" Agility

Despite its compact size, the Jaguar E-PACE carries significant weight.

  • The Advantage: The massive 420mm Carbon Ceramic discs weigh approximately 50% less than equivalent steel rotors.

  • The Impact: Reducing "unsprung weight" by nearly 15-20kg across the chassis allows the suspension to react faster. This sharpens steering response and significantly reduces the "heavy-nose" feeling (understeer) during spirited cornering.

2. Front Axle: 2F16L Monobloc 6-Piston Power

  • Engineering Excellence: The CTE RACING 2F16L calipers are machined from a single block of aerospace-grade aluminum (Monobloc). This provides superior rigidity compared to multi-piece or OEM floating calipers.

  • Thermal Stability: Paired with 420x38mm CCB discs, this system can withstand temperatures exceeding 1,000°C. Whether navigating steep mountain passes or high-speed motorways, you will experience zero brake fade and a consistent, firm pedal feel.

3. Rear Axle: Seamless EPB Integration

One of the biggest challenges in upgrading the E-PACE is the Electronic Parking Brake (EPB).

  • The Solution: The CTE RACING Rear EPB Motor Calipers are engineered to be 100% compatible with Jaguar’s factory electronic handbrake protocol.

  • Clean Installation: This is a "Plug & Play" solution that retains all safety features without the need for unsightly "dual-caliper" setups or wiring modifications. The 380x30mm CCB discs ensure perfect visual and mechanical balance.

4. Dust-Free Elegance & Wheel Protection

  • Clean Aesthetics: Carbon Ceramic material produces virtually zero brake dust. Your 20-inch or 21-inch wheels will remain clean and brilliant even after long drives.

  • Corrosion Resistance: Unlike steel discs, CCB rotors do not rust after car washes or exposure to humid environments, maintaining their high-tech, deep-grey appearance for years.
